Lines Matching +full:64 +full:m
238 case 'd': // Floating point register (containing 64-bit value) in validateAsmConstraint()
254 case 'i': // FP or VSX register to hold 64-bit integers data in validateAsmConstraint()
276 case 'M': // Constant larger than 31 in validateAsmConstraint()
284 case 'm': // Memory operand. Note that on PowerPC targets, m can in validateAsmConstraint()
286 // is therefore only safe to use `m' in an asm statement in validateAsmConstraint()
291 // asm ("st%U0 %1,%0" : "=m" (mem) : "r" (val)); in validateAsmConstraint()
293 // asm ("st %1,%0" : "=m" (mem) : "r" (val)); in validateAsmConstraint()
294 // is not. Use es rather than m if you don't want the base in validateAsmConstraint()
301 // `m', this constraint can be used in asm statements that in validateAsmConstraint()
308 // usually better to use `m' or `es' in asm statements) in validateAsmConstraint()
312 // register (it is usually better to use `m' or `es' in in validateAsmConstraint()
321 case 'S': // Constant suitable as a 64-bit mask operand in validateAsmConstraint()
361 if (LongDoubleWidth == 64) in getLongDoubleMangling()
404 resetDataLayout("E-m:a-p:32:32-Fi32-i64:64-n32"); in PPC32TargetInfo()
406 resetDataLayout("e-m:e-p:32:32-Fn32-i64:64-n32"); in PPC32TargetInfo()
408 resetDataLayout("E-m:e-p:32:32-Fn32-i64:64-n32"); in PPC32TargetInfo()
422 LongDoubleWidth = 64; in PPC32TargetInfo()
432 LongDoubleWidth = LongDoubleAlign = 64; in PPC32TargetInfo()
456 LongWidth = LongAlign = PointerWidth = PointerAlign = 64; in PPC64TargetInfo()
463 DataLayout = "E-m:a-Fi64-i64:64-n32:64"; in PPC64TargetInfo()
464 LongDoubleWidth = 64; in PPC64TargetInfo()
468 DataLayout = "e-m:e-Fn32-i64:64-n32:64"; in PPC64TargetInfo()
471 DataLayout = "E-m:e"; in PPC64TargetInfo()
479 DataLayout += "-i64:64-n32:64"; in PPC64TargetInfo()
483 LongDoubleWidth = LongDoubleAlign = 64; in PPC64TargetInfo()
494 MaxAtomicInlineWidth = 64; in PPC64TargetInfo()